Transaction cd64a66259c7cdeb4f61ad981f24ebcf54ae84c5e810b18f8cf07e1270c5302f
1 Input
1 Output
-
cd64a66259c7cdeb4f61ad981f24ebcf54ae84c5e810b18f8cf07e1270c5302f:0
- value
- 70671800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dffb102501b6f0f519a772555bd16795f1bc9e8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 187RLXNuw6pz7AHcDcvEjxQR2vWp9SAmqJ